Advanced Wireless Settings for WPS and WDS

The Advanced Wireless Settings screen includes settings for Push 'N' Connect (WPS) and for
Wireless Distribution System (WDS) setup. From the main menu, select Advanced Wireless
Settings to display the following screen:

WPS (Push 'N' Connect). The WPS settings show the modem router PIN, and the Keep
Existing Wireless Settings
check box.

By default, the Keep Existing Wireless Settings check box is cleared. This allows the modem
router to automatically generate the SSID and WPA/WPA2 security settings when it
implements WPS. After WPS is implemented, the modem router automatically selects this
check box so that your SSID and wireless security settings remain the same if other WPS-
enabled devices are added later.

If you configure your wireless router settings and security manually, the Keep Existing
Wireless Settings
radio box will also be enabled. This will allow you to use WPS (Push 'N'
Connect) to connect additional WPS capable devices to your wireless network using the
existing settings.

Note: To make sure that your new wireless settings remain in effect, verify that the

Keep Existing Wireless Settings checkbox is selected in the WPS Settings
screen.
